Bathroom Tile Installation in Denver County, CO

Bathroom tile installation services encompass the process of adding new tiles or replacing existing ones in bathroom spaces, including showers, bathtubs, floors, and walls. These projects often involve selecting durable, water-resistant tiles such as ceramic, porcelain, or natural stone, and ensuring proper layout, surface preparation, and sealing for a long-lasting finish. Property owners typically seek this service to update the appearance of their bathrooms, improve water resistance, or repair damaged tiles, and may have questions about tile choices, surface preparation, and the scope of work involved.

Before requesting bathroom tile installation, homeowners should consider factors such as the overall design style, preferred materials, and budget constraints. It’s also helpful to understand the condition of existing surfaces, the level of customization desired, and any specific waterproofing or sealing requirements.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project meets expectations and results in a functional, attractive bathroom space.

FAQ

Bathroom Tile Installation Questions

What types of tiles are suitable for bathroom installation? Ceramic, porcelain, and natural stone tiles are common choices for bathroom walls and floors due to their durability and water resistance.

Can existing bathroom surfaces be tiled over? In many cases, existing surfaces like old tiles or smooth concrete can be prepared and tiled over, but proper assessment is recommended.

What should be considered when choosing grout for bathroom tiles? It's important to select a grout that resists moisture and staining to maintain the appearance and longevity of the tile installation.

Is waterproofing necessary for bathroom tile installation? Yes, waterproofing is essential to prevent water damage and mold growth behind the tiles, especially in showers and wet areas.
